CAR BUYER WITH CASH? OR GOT A PREAPPROVED LOAN? Car Dealers are notorious abusers of Consumer Credit Rights, and they can RUIN your Credit. You DON'T have to put up with it! If you're paying cash, or have your own financing, you DO NOT need to fill out credit applications.

If you later find out your credit was run without your consent (be sure to check right after dealer visit, or better yet have a credit freeze or at least alerts set up), hire a FRCA lawyer to sue the dealer. It’s easy because the statute allows the consumer to recover attorneys’ fees, and there are statutory damages on top of any injunctive relief you can obtain (like a court order requiring the dealer to report to the credit reporting agencies that your credit was pulled without your consent).

A burning question I have is, "Can I refuse to provide my drivers license when I test drive?".

One place I read, "Many car dealers ask for your driver's license when you go for a test drive, and they will make a photocopy of it. They claim it is required for insurance purposes."

Another place I read, "Car dealerships have to carry fleet insurance on all of the vehicles on their lot, and a test driver is usually covered under that policy. Usually, fleet coverage will cover all damages that result from an accident that happens during a test drive, regardless of whose fault the accident was."

So if the dealership's Fleet Insurance covers any damages from a test drive, then why would a dealer need to photocopy the license card for insurance purposes?
